Popis: Euphorbia resinifera and Euphorbia echinus are Moroccan endemic plants that are used in traditional medicine for their therapeutic properties. The aim of this research is to study the phenolic compounds content, the antioxidant and the antibacterial activities of two Euphorbiaceae species: Euphorbia resinifera and Euphorbia echinus, which were collected in Béni-Mellal and Agadir regions, respectively. The current study involved determining the concentration of phenolics, flavonoids, and tannins of our spieces using spectrophotometry. To test the antioxidant activity of the two methanolic extracts, the DPPH° technique was used.Also, the antibacterial activity against three microorganisms was tested in vitro. The quantification of phenolic compounds revealed that Euphorbia resiniferamethanolic extract had the highest concentration of phenolics. The methanolic extract of Euphorbia resinifera and Euphorbia echinus showed a higher antioxidant activity than Ascorbic acid.The antibacterial analysis showed a positive correlation between antioxidant activity and total phenolic content. Our extracts exhibited antibacterial activity against Staphylococcus aureus and Bacillus subtilis. In contrast, it had no inhibitory effect on Escherichia coli.
